I'm currently using a PXE setup where I'm trying to install Windows 11 from another PC over the network. I've configured Samba on my PXE server, but I'm noticing that the "net use" command doesn't always work. Sometimes it connects right away, and other times I get a connection error and need to try again. Is this a common behavior with Samba and PXE setups, or is there a better way to handle the connection? I'd appreciate any tips or insight!
2 Answers
It sounds like you're facing a bit of a challenge there! Sometimes with Samba, especially in a PE environment, it can be a bit hit or miss. A lot of people find that adding a loop to the "net use" command can help—it keeps trying until it finally gets a connection. In my experience, it can just take some time for everything to load properly in WinPE, so don't lose hope!
I totally get it! When I had a similar issue, I set a delay after initializing WinPE. Waiting about 10-15 seconds before running "net use" made a significant difference. It seems the network drivers and modules can take a moment to kick in. Give that a shot and see if it helps!
